Just replaced the head gasket on my sons 1994 HZ Toyota ute. (The old one was leaking)
When all replaced the motor was started ok but when motor revved up a louder than normal knock was noticed that seemed to be coming from the top of the motor and probably between the middle and the rear of the motor. Seemed to be normal while at idle. As stated previously this knock was more pronounced when motor revved up.
Does any one know any thing to check before major pull down again?

I really hope that you made sure you fitted the correct thickness of head gasket?
Pretty sure that the 1HZ has the same setup as the 2L/3L. there are 3 thicknesses and if you put a thinner one on the pistons will be tapping the head.

If you are sure you have fitted the correct one (there will be a letter stamped on the old one and a notch at a certain point to identify) then Id crack each injector line to find which one is the problem, and re-bleed at the same time as said above.

Yeah fisho is right, different head gasket thicknesses, funny thing is there are 5 different possible from factory but only 3 available as a spare part. Is it possible that one (or more) pre-combustion chambers could have come loose when you took the head off?

Bros.
Have you re checked the valve timing via the timing belt.
If this is not absolutely spot on a valve can be contacting a piston at at tdc.
A worst case scenario could be a loose big end bearing. How is the oil pressure when hot?
